Laying on floor attempting to repair an elbow on an IS Machine

while needing to lay on the floor to gain access for replacing an elbow under shop 11 IS machine section 6. EE began to experience muscle cramps and muscle spasms. His condition was quickly identified and was immediately cared for and transported to a medical care facility where fluids were administered.

Heat Cramps

Heat

While laying on floor to repair an elbow experienced heat cramps
